Hi all,

My Girl friend (5'4" Normal Build. Size 6 Mens shoe) recently had to get fins at the last minute. The dive shop she got them at didnt have ANY fins for "females"

Is this typical? Is there even a "female" fin available on the market?

Anyway she wanted to get the same fins I have (TUSA X-Pert Zoom Split fins) but even the smallest size was to big on her. After getting the smallest fin available in the store she complained later that the fins still had a little right/left wobble on her foot (even with a 3mm bootie).

The LDS states that this wobble was normal and fine. Is this true cause my fins nor my best friend's fins wobble? Any other ladies out there having trouble fitting scuba gear?
 
As far as I know they do not make men's and women's fins they are unisex.

As for the wobble, they are too big, take them back and tell the shop to order some smaller fins in or get your money back. You have been fed a line. This is what gives shops a bad name, sell them SOMETHING even if it's the wrong size.

I agree..the shop was just out to make a buck. I suggest taking them back, and either getting another pair (if they got new fins in yet) or just getting your money back.

One thing you may want to try, if your girlfriend really wants the Zoom fins..try them on with thicker soled booties. The extra thickness may just be enough to make the fins fit securely. People with size 6 feet are kind of hard to fit sometimes, especially if they have a narrow foot.

Two good fins to try on small narrow feet are Mares Quattro and Scubapro TwinJets. They seem to have the most flexible foot pockets and fit smaller feet better. I think some Mares fins come in X-small also..but not sure about that one.

Scubabunny (et al) are right. There should be no wobble in the fins... take 'em back!

Mares does make a wide range of fin sizes in Quattros, Plana Avantis, etc., etc., etc. So do their new sister company Dacor. Between these two I'm sure your lady will find a properly fitting fin that will do the job.

I think the women's equivalent of a men's size 6 is a 7.5 or 8 in US shoe sizes, or 24.5 to 25 cm. Women's feet are generally narrower, though. In any event, she should take those fins back and go shopping for a new pair, maybe at a different retailer. Take the booties along to make sure it works, too. I just bought a new pair of booties, and because of thicker soles and more rubber on the toes, I can barely get the old fins (Blades) past my toes. Fortunately, my sweetie has some Mares fins that will work...all footpockets are not created equal.
